Product Introduction

CP (Commercially Pure) Titanium Plates are a versatile and high-performance material widely used in industries requiring materials with excellent corrosion resistance, high strength, and biocompatibility. This titanium plate is made from pure titanium, which offers exceptional resistance to corrosion in many different environments. With its lightweight and durable characteristics, CP Titanium Plate is the ideal choice for industries such as aerospace, medical devices, energy, and chemical processing.

Technical Specifications

The following table provides the detailed specifications for CP Titanium Plate:

Property Value
Material Commercially Pure Titanium
Grades Grade 1, Grade 2, Grade 3
Density 4.51 g/cm³
Tensile Strength 240 - 550 MPa
Yield Strength 170 - 380 MPa
Elongation 20 - 25%
Hardness 120 - 160 Vickers
Modulus of Elasticity 110 - 120 GPa
Melting Point 1,668°C
Thermal Conductivity 21.9 W/m·K
Electrical Resistivity 0.43 µΩ·cm
Corrosion Resistance Excellent in oxidizing and reducing environments

Main Standards for CP Titanium Plate:

  • USA: ASTM B265, ASTM F67, ASTM F136
  • Russia: GOST 19807, GOST 19808
  • Japan: JIS H 4600, JIS H 4650

Applications

  • Aerospace and Aviation: CP Titanium Plate is used in aircraft parts such as fuselage structures, wings, and turbine blades, where strength-to-weight ratio is crucial.
  • Medical Devices and Healthcare: Its excellent biocompatibility makes it ideal for implants, surgical instruments, and prosthetics.
  • Chemical Processing: Used in equipment like reactors, pipes, and storage tanks that need resistance to corrosive chemicals.
  • Energy Sector: Employed in nuclear power plants, wind turbines, and solar energy systems for its corrosion resistance and strength.
  • Marine Engineering: CP Titanium Plate is extensively used in shipbuilding and offshore structures for its resistance to saltwater corrosion.
  • Industrial Manufacturing: Ideal for manufacturing high-strength tools, fasteners, and other industrial components.

Manufacturing Process

The production of CP Titanium Plates involves several critical processes to ensure high quality and consistency:

  1. Melting: High-purity titanium is melted using Vacuum Arc Remelting (VAR) or Electron Beam Melting (EBM) techniques.
  2. Rolling: The melted titanium is rolled into thin plates using hot and cold rolling techniques, ensuring the desired thickness and surface finish.
  3. Annealing: To improve the material's properties, the plates are subjected to heat treatment processes.
  4. Cutting: Plates are cut to precise dimensions using high-precision machinery.
  5. Surface Treatment: CP Titanium Plates undergo surface treatments, including pickling or polishing, to enhance corrosion resistance and finish.
